I'm wondering if it is possible to automatically create a Jira from a .csv or .txt by dropping in a network folder?  Or if there's some other process to do this?  The manual import would not work well with the number of tickets we would be creating on a daily basis.

I do not believe there are built-in functions to do that.

Some other options are:

  • set up a mail handler in Jira, email to a address which then consumes the emails to create issues
  • investigate the Atlassian Marketplace for addon tools to watch the folder/add the issues
  • build your own application to watch the folder, and then call the Jira REST API to add the issues directly
  • build a process which generates the issues, and use an Automation for Jira rule and a webhook to consume the messages and add the issues
